What to Focus On

  • An equation shows equality between two expressions.
  • A variable is the unknown quantity to be found.
  • The solution or root is the value that makes the equation true.

  • Adding the same number on both sides keeps the equation equal.
  • Subtracting the same number on both sides keeps the equation equal.
  • Multiplying both sides by the same number keeps the equation equal.

  • Undo addition by subtraction.
  • Undo subtraction by addition.
  • Undo multiplication by division.
